What are the common pitfalls to avoid when trading cryptocurrencies?

- Shine CrossifixioJul 12, 2025 · a year agoOne common pitfall to avoid when trading cryptocurrencies is not doing proper research. It's important to thoroughly understand the project behind a cryptocurrency before investing in it. This includes researching the team, the technology, and the market demand for the cryptocurrency. Without proper research, you may end up investing in a project that has no real value or potential for growth.
- Osama Ahmed QureshiJul 01, 2024 · 2 years agoAnother common mistake is not setting a stop-loss order. A stop-loss order is a predetermined price at which you will sell your cryptocurrency to limit your losses. By not setting a stop-loss order, you risk losing a significant amount of money if the price of the cryptocurrency suddenly drops. It's important to set a stop-loss order to protect your investment.

- abolfazl khJan 30, 2026 · 5 months agoOne mistake that many traders make is letting emotions drive their trading decisions. It's important to approach cryptocurrency trading with a clear and rational mindset. Don't let fear or greed dictate your actions. Stick to your trading plan and strategy, and don't make impulsive decisions based on short-term market fluctuations. Emotions can cloud your judgment and lead to poor trading outcomes.
- Mohamed EL TahanMay 09, 2024 · 2 years agoA common pitfall to avoid is not diversifying your cryptocurrency portfolio. Investing all your money in one cryptocurrency is risky because if that particular cryptocurrency fails, you could lose everything. It's important to spread your investments across different cryptocurrencies to reduce risk. This way, if one cryptocurrency performs poorly, others may offset the losses.
- Alok KumarJan 02, 2021 · 5 years agoOne mistake that beginners often make is not using proper security measures. Cryptocurrency trading involves dealing with digital assets, and it's crucial to protect your investments from hackers and scams. Use strong and unique passwords, enable two-factor authentication, and store your cryptocurrencies in secure wallets. Taking these security precautions can help safeguard your funds.
- João RuasDec 16, 2025 · 6 months agoWhen trading cryptocurrencies, it's important to avoid chasing quick profits. Many traders fall into the trap of buying cryptocurrencies that have already experienced significant price increases, hoping to make a quick profit. However, this strategy often leads to buying at the top and selling at a loss. It's important to do your own analysis and not follow the herd mentality.
- tako0707Dec 31, 2021 · 4 years agoOne common pitfall to avoid is overtrading. Some traders get caught up in the excitement of the market and make too many trades, thinking they can time the market perfectly. However, frequent trading can lead to higher transaction fees and increased risk. It's important to have a well-defined trading strategy and stick to it, rather than constantly chasing every market movement.
